Facts

Facts about
  • The life of black currant plant is 20-30 years.
  • Oil extracted from black currant seeds is used in production of skin care products.
  • Black currant berries are major source of food for the birds.
  
  • When carambola is cut horizontally, it forms a star.
  • It is believed that carambola helps to cure hangover.
  • Entire carambola is edible, including its skin.
  • 2 varieties of carambola are cultivated: tart & sweet.

Difference Between Blackcurrant and Carambola

We might think that Blackcurrant and Carambola are similar with respect to nutritional value and health benefits. But the nutrient content of both fruits is different. Blackcurrant and Carambola Facts such as their taste, shape, color, and size are also distinct. The difference between Blackcurrant and Carambola is explained here.

The amount of calories in 100 gm of fresh Blackcurrant and Carambola with peel is 63.00 kcal and 31.00 kcal and the amount of calories without peel is Not Available and Not Available respectively. Thus, Blackcurrant and Carambola belong to Low Calorie Fruits and Low Calorie Fruits category.These fruits might or might not differ with respect to their scientific classification. The order of Blackcurrant and Carambola is Saxifragales and Oxalidales respectively. Blackcurrant belongs to Grossulariaceae family and Carambola belongs to Oxalidaceae family. Blackcurrant belongs to Ribes genus of R. nigrum species and Carambola belongs to Averrhoa genus of A. carambola species. Beings plants, both fruits belong to Plantae Kingdom.
